vitamin D’s power to fight COVID

Steve from Hope

It seems a given that Covid is here to stay, combined with potential super spreaders in the community such as the Free Market at the A&P show grounds , people need to take it seriously.
it appears that scientific research has shown that vitamin deficiency has a strong link between death or serious illness among patients.
"Israel scientists say they have gathered the most convincing evidence to date that increased vitamin D levels can help COVID-19 patients reduce the risk of serious illness or death."
while in the Middle east 4 out of 5 are deficient , " About 5% of adults in New Zealand are deficient in vitamin D. A further 27% are below the recommended blood level of vitamin D. People with darker skin, who spend less time outside or who have health conditions that make it hard to absorb nutrients are more at risk of vitamin D deficiency."
